Mohali, June 28

Advertisement

Even as the Mohali Municipal Corporation has passed the resolution to extend its boundaries by including new sectors and various villages, the Azad group today alleged that it was being done to “benefit only one person”.

Advertisement

Addressing the mediapersons, Parminder Singh Sohana, senior leader of the Azad group, said in the earlier meeting they had demanded separate bylaws for city and villages.

Parminder said after inclusion of villages in municipal limits the residents would have to pay property tax at par with the people living in the city.

Parminder further said despite several reminders the MC had failed to declare the president and members of the Bal Gopal Gaushala. — TNS
